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Invergordon to Newport (Essex) start from as little as £48.90

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Invergordon to Newport (Essex) start from £122.20 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Invergordon to Newport (Essex) are available for £217.70 one way

Invergordon station, although small, offers basic facilities for travelers. It’s important to note that there isn’t a ticket office or machines for buying or collecting tickets at the station, so be sure to purchase your tickets online in advance. However, the station does feature smartcard validators and an induction loop, making it a convenient stop for tech-savvy travelers. Moreover, while no direct staff assistance is available, there is a help point for any required information.

Access and Amenities

When considering accessibility, Invergordon station is categorized as a Category B station. This provides level access to platform 1 and a ramp leading to platform 2, though travelers should be mindful of the potential gap between train and platform. While the station lacks immediate amenities such as toilets, refreshment facilities, and Wi-Fi, there is a seating area where travelers can relax before their journey. Bicycle enthusiasts will find storage facilities with the provision to park up to 10 bikes.

Onward Travel Options

The station offers a variety of transport links, facilitating smooth onward journeys. Bus services are accessible from the High Street, with the station sign marking the bus stop point. For reference, detailed information on bus services can be found on the Traveline Scotland website or by calling their 24-hour hotline. For those preferring private transport, taxis are available, and more information can be accessed through TrainTaxi. While direct car hire facilities are not available on-site, a trip to the town center can yield further options.

Station Facilities and Ticketing

Newport (Essex) station is equipped with facilities to cater to both regular commuters and occasional travelers. The ticket office is open from 06:00 to 09:10 on weekdays, with convenient 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ets at any time. The station has enabled smart card services as well, including issuance and verification, to expedite your commuting process.

For those in need of assistance, customer information is readily available at the ticket office during operating hours. The station offers step-free access to platforms, although wheelchair access across platforms involves a footbridge. While facilities like an induction loop and accessible ticket machines support inclusivity, there are currently no accessible taxis or specialized mobility set down points provided.

Travel Connections and Amenities

Beyond rail services, Newport (Essex) station has enabled connections with other transport modes. There is a designated rail replacement service stop, though accessibility considerations are noted. Taxis can be booked by calling 01799 661266, and you can find more details at www.audleyendtaxis.com. Local bus services also offer convenient options for your onward journey.

While the station doesn’t host refreshment services, shops, or currency exchanges, it offers other traveler-friendly features such as public WiFi, which you can find more about through this WiFi locator.
